Accreditations & Affiliations
The Children’s Home is distinguished by the following accreditations and affiliations:
- Certified by the Ohio Department of Mental Health
- Licensed by the Ohio Department of Job and Family Services
- Accredited by the Council on Accreditation for Children and Family Services
- Founding Member of the Child Welfare League of America
- United Way Agency
- Certified by the Ohio Department of Education
- Accredited by the National Association for the Education of Young Children
- Founding Member of the Ohio Association of Child Caring Agencies
- Certified by the Teaching-Family Association in use of the Teaching Family Model.
- 3 Star Rating from Ohio's Setp Up to Quality
- Hamilton County Mental Health & Recovery Services Board

The Consortium for Resilient Young Children
The Consortium for Resilient Young Children (CRYC) is a collaboration of specialists in mental health and early child care and education. Founded by The Children's Home of Cincinnati, the CRYC exists to improve the social and emotional development of young children to prepare them for successful entry into Kindergarten. The CRYC includes the following community partners:
- The Children's Home of Cincinnati
- Central Clinic
- Children, Inc.
- Cincinnati Early Learning Centers
- Cincinnati Public Schools
- Dr. Dorothy June Sciarra, Professor Emeritus
- 4C for Children
- NorthKey Community Care
- Talbert House
The CRYC is proud to be a United Way Community Partner.
SPARK: Supporting Partnerships to Assure Ready Kids
SPARK is a comprehensive program that supports the healthy social, emotional, and cognitive development of children, and works hand-in-hand with families to support school readiness and with schools to support the successful transition of children into the educational system. The goal of the SPARK program is to create children who are ready to succeed in kindergarten and schools that are ready to educate all children. SPARK includes the following community partners:
The Children's Home of Cincinnati
United Way of Greater Cincinnati
Cincinnati Public Schools
Public Library of Cincinnati and Hamilton County
University of Cincinnati
Santa Maria Community Services
